Brock Purdy and the San Francisco 49ers are on a hot streak right now, winning their first five regular-season games of the 2023 NFL season. Despite that, they’re still focused as ever on beating the best week in and week out, with their next test coming in Cleveland.
Although the 49ers have put up 30 points or more in each game in 2023, Purdy isn’t taking it easy with the Browns.
The Browns have rejuvenated their defense this season under Jim Schwartz, ranking in the top three of most defensive metrics. In fact, they are ahead of the 49ers in points allowed (60) and rushing yards allowed (287).
And while Cleveland’s offense will likely be without starting quarterback Deshaun Watson Sunday, their defense still presents one of the toughest challenges in the NFL.
“Yeah, really good challenge for us. Up front, they do a great job with, I feel like just getting after the offensive line and pushing them back and getting up on the quarterback’s toes,” Brock Purdy said. “They do a great job of that.”

The Browns do such a good job of getting pressure that they remind him of the 49ers defense to a degree.
Cleveland uses all-world pass rushers Myles Garrett and Za’Darius Smith in various looks throughout the game, keeping opposing offenses wary at all times. That’s similar to what Purdy has faced going against his own defense, expecting another big test against one of the league’s best.
“In camp we did go against that [type of defense] every day,” the QB added. “We got another challenge in front of us this week with these guys. So they’re, I think one of the best in the league and a really talented group. So, excited to go against them.”
That fire to succeed comes from his own personal vendetta to prove himself every day. Sure, being the last pick in the draft plays a factor, but it’s the potential of his own, and the team’s, abilities that drives him the most.
And while he doesn’t know if the offense will ever have that “perfect game”, he sure as hell is going to keep trying to achieve that each week for the 49ers.
“No matter what everyone else is saying man, I know that there is another level that I can get to,” Brock Purdy stated.
